Ro Water Purification in Bergen County, NJ

RO water purification services involve installing and maintaining systems that remove impurities and contaminants from tap water, providing homeowners with cleaner, better-tasting drinking water. These services typically cover the assessment of water quality, the installation of reverse osmosis units, and ongoing maintenance to ensure optimal performance. Property owners often seek these services when they notice issues such as foul odors, sediment, or unusual tastes in their water, or when testing reveals the presence of harmful substances like chlorine, lead, or other contaminants.

Before requesting RO water purification, property owners should understand their current water quality and the specific contaminants they want to address. It's also helpful to consider the size of the household and daily water usage to select the appropriate system capacity. Additionally, understanding the maintenance requirements and the lifespan of the system can assist in making an informed decision. Proper evaluation ensures the installation of a system that effectively meets the household’s needs for safe and clean drinking water.

FAQ

Ro Water Purification Questions

What is RO water purification? RO water purification uses a semi-permeable membrane to remove impurities and contaminants from water, providing cleaner drinking water for households.

What types of property projects often need RO systems? RO systems are commonly used for homes, apartments, and small commercial properties seeking to improve tap water quality.

How does an RO system improve water quality? It reduces dissolved solids, contaminants, and impurities, resulting in clearer, better-tasting water suitable for drinking and cooking.

What should property owners consider before installing an RO system? It’s important to assess water quality, household water usage, and available space for the system installation.
